Found out from AKA that
1) Tech classes are free.
2) A tech class will be held at MMG unless there is another tournament they are attending that weekend.
3) They will know for sure when MMG is coming close.

MMG is Michigan Monster Game. It's held annually at Hells Survivors in Pinckney MI. The website can be found through http://www.exoticsportz.com/mgame.htm
It's a BYOP big/huge game. Had a blast last year and several Wiseguys are returning this year.

Age for tech class
Don't know if they have a specified age minimum, but when we bought our Excaliburs, Hyperactive went through the class as a complete team. My son is only 13 and they had no problem with him going through it. The really great thing is there was no reason for any concern about it... the markers are really quite simplistic in design. They weren't kidding when they said their intent was to "KISS" (Keep It Simple Stupid). They are very sound, and easy to work on, as long as you pay attention to the few places where you need to observe certain precautions with assembly/dissassembly.
